Critical Questions About Left-Sided Infective Endocarditis.

J Alberto San Román1, Isidre Vilacosta2, Javier López1

  • 1Instituto de Ciencias del Corazón (ICICOR), Hospital Clínico, Valladolid, Spain.

Journal of the American College of Cardiology
|August 29, 2015
PubMed
Summary

Research on infective endocarditis, a high-mortality cardiovascular disease, lags due to uncommon cases and funding issues. This review highlights evidence gaps and proposes new approaches for left-sided infective endocarditis research.

Area of Science:

  • Cardiovascular Medicine
  • Infective Endocarditis Research

Background:

  • Infective endocarditis (IE) has high mortality but lacks robust scientific evidence for treatment.
  • Research in IE is hindered by its rarity, limited multicenter registries, and funding shortages.
  • Challenges include the cost and ethical considerations of randomization and reliance on observational data.

Purpose of the Study:

  • To identify critical areas needing evidence in left-sided infective endocarditis (LSIE).
  • To propose a novel strategy for advancing LSIE research.
  • To summarize existing evidence and outline future research directions.

Main Methods:

  • Review of current literature on infective endocarditis.
  • Analysis of challenges impeding clinical research in IE.
  • Formulation of recommendations for future research methodologies.

Main Results:

  • Significant gaps exist in the evidence base for IE treatment.
  • Current research approaches are insufficient to address critical questions in LSIE.
  • A need for innovative and collaborative research strategies is identified.

Conclusions:

  • Urgent need for dedicated research to improve outcomes for infective endocarditis.
  • Proposed approaches aim to overcome existing barriers to IE research.
  • Advancing LSIE understanding requires a concerted effort and new methodologies.
